During a press conference, the Cyprus Peace Platform demanded a population census on both sides of the island prior to a referendum after the negotiation process. “Before a referendum takes place, a simultaneous census must be made on both sides, under international supervision”, urged the platform. They continued adding that a solution must be based on the July 1st agreement for a united federal Cyprus with one sovereignty, one national identity, one citizenship, bi-communal, bizonal and based on equality. The solution must also be based on the decisions of the UN Security Council. In its statement, the platform added that an early solution is something all Cypriots need.
The platform in order to contribute to an early solution, asked for more confidence building measures like the opening of more gates, the reduction of the bureaucracy at the check-points, demilitarization, the reciprocal abolition of military manoeuvres, the elimination of chauvinistic elements in education and the opening of Varosha area to its former owners for settlement.
